Kinds Of Scaffolding
Although scaffolding systems can differ commonly in layout and application, they typically fall under numerous distinct groups that accommodate different construction needs - Scaffolding. The most usual kinds consist of sustained scaffolding, put on hold scaffolding, and rolling scaffolding
Sustained scaffolding consists of platforms sustained by a framework of posts, which give a steady and raised working surface area. This kind is normally utilized for jobs that call for substantial altitude, such as bricklaying or outside painting.
Suspended scaffolding, alternatively, is utilized for projects needing access to high altitudes, such as cleaning or fixing building facades. This system hangs from one more structure or a rooftop, enabling employees to reduced or raise the platform as required.
Moving scaffolding features wheels that enable very easy mobility across a task website. It is especially valuable for jobs that call for regular moving, such as interior operate in large spaces.
Each type of scaffolding is designed with specific applications in mind, making sure that building and construction tasks can be executed successfully and effectively. Comprehending these categories is crucial for selecting the proper scaffolding system to fulfill both project demands and website conditions.
Key Security Functions
Security is paramount in scaffolding systems, as the potential risks linked with functioning at elevations can lead to major mishaps if not effectively handled. Key security functions are important to guarantee the health of workers and the honesty of the building and construction website.
Firstly, guardrails are vital. These obstacles provide a physical protect versus falls, significantly lowering the risk of major injuries. Additionally, toe boards are often made use of to avoid tools and materials from diminishing the scaffold, protecting employees listed below.
An additional essential element is the use of non-slip surface areas on platforms. This function boosts grip, particularly in negative weather condition problems, therefore decreasing the likelihood of slides and falls. Furthermore, access ladders ought to be securely placed to help with secure entrance and exit from the scaffold.
Normal inspections and upkeep of scaffolding systems are additionally vital. These evaluations make certain that all components are in good problem and functioning appropriately, addressing any type of wear or damage without delay.
Finally, appropriate training for all employees involved in scaffolding operations is vital to ensure that they comprehend safety and security protocols and can determine possible dangers. Maintenance and Assessments
The effectiveness of scaffolding systems prolongs past first layout and application; continuous upkeep and routine assessments are crucial to ensuring their continued performance and security throughout the period of a task. Regular examinations must be carried out by certified personnel to recognize any indicators of wear, damages, or instability that might jeopardize the integrity of the scaffolding.
Upkeep procedures must consist of routine checks of architectural elements, such as frames, slabs, and fittings, ensuring that all aspects continue to be safe and secure and totally free from rust or various other wear and tear. In addition, the capability of safety functions, such as guardrails and toe boards, must be assessed to guarantee compliance with safety and security policies.
Documentation of all assessments and maintenance activities is important for responsibility and governing compliance. A systematic approach to record-keeping not only aids in tracking the condition of the scaffolding but likewise supplies needed proof in case of an occurrence.
Inevitably, developing a thorough upkeep and inspection schedule will significantly minimize the risk of mishaps and enhance the total security of the building and construction website. By focusing on these practices, construction supervisors can safeguard workers and maintain the task's integrity.
